Mental Health Awareness Week – Messages of Hope

As part of Mental Health Awareness Week, these messages of hope are shared to remind anyone struggling that even in the hardest moments, small steps and support can make a difference.

If you need support, help is available:

  • Samaritans: 116 123 (24/7, free)
  • Text: SHOUT to 85258 for free crisis support
  • More help: https://ollysfuture.org.uk/get-help/
  • Urgent medical advice: Call NHS 111 (England) or NHS Direct (Wales)
